Samsung D840 Review
The phone comes with a large & colourful screen which can be viewed when the D840 is in its slide open & slide closed position. The screen provides a clear & bright 2.12 Inch display for the user to view their menu, photos, messages, video, music information, Internet & games. The user can use the external keys & navigation which is situated under the large screen & can be used when the phone is closed. The phone comes with a stylish keypad which can be used when the handset is in its slide open position & the keys are etched into the metal surface which is easy to use & looks highly attractive.
The phone is neat & compact which is only 11.9mm in thickness & ideal for single handed operation. The D840 is 99mm tall & 51mm wide which makes it perfect for carrying with the user at all times. The handset weighs 100 grams including the fitted battery & no extra memory card which is lightweight but still provides a solid & sturdy feel to the mobile handset. The battery will provide up to two & a half hours talk time & approximately two hundred & fifty hours of standby battery time.



The D840 is full of fun & entertaining features which allows the user to do so much more than simply communicate with others. The phone comes with an integrated 2 megapixel digital camera which comes with a digital zoom & flash. The user can snap away & store all their fun moments in their day as a still photo. The user can share their photos with others via the MMS multimedia messaging service which can be sent to any MMS multimedia messaging compatible mobile phone user. The user can record video clips & playback video which has been sent to them from other users. The Samsung D840 will ensure the user has all the imaging features that could be desired on a mobile handset.
The fun doesn't stop their as the user can download music in all popular music file formats & play them on the integrated music player. The user can connect their handset to their laptop or PC & download music using either a USB cable connection or Bluetooth® wireless connectivity. The Bluetooth® Technology allows the user to connect their Samsung D840 to any Bluetooth® compatible device & enjoy a wireless connection between devices. The phone comes with EDGE technology which allows the user to enjoy fast music & video transfers on their mobile phone.
The user can access a selection of messaging services from the phones main menu which include SMS text messages, MMS multimedia messages & an email service. The user can create, send & receive messaging on their Samsung D840. The user can send any type of message to their contacts as long as the contact has a compatible message service. The MMS service allows the user to share their photos & video with work colleagues, friends & family who have a MMS compatible mobile phone.
The super stylish Samsung D840 comes with a TV output facility & allows the user to view Microsoft documents including Word, PowerPoint, Excel & PDF files. The handset comes with preloaded games which offer the user a lively & colourful gaming experience. The user can surf the Web using the built in WAP browser which allows the user to have a mobile Web experience on their D840.
Samsung D840 Specifications & Features
Screen
2.12 Inch QVGA 262k Colour Screen (240 x 320 Pixels)
Imaging
2 Megapixel Camera
Flash
Digital Zoom
Photo Effects
Camera Settings
Video Recorder
Video Player
Wallpaper
Screensaver
Messaging
SMS (Text Messaging)
EMS (Enhanced Messaging)
MMS (Multimedia Messaging)
Email
Predictive Text T9
Sound
Music Player (MP3, AAC, ACC+ & WMA)
Polyphonic Ringtones (64 Voices)
MP3 Ringtones
Voice Memo
Handsfree Speaker
Entertainment
Embedded Games
Downloadable Games
Java™ Games

Reviewer: Sims T - Barnstaple, UK
Date: 26th Aug 2007
I purchased the oh so sleek & shiny D840 ultra in chrome just 6 days ago. My phones so far have been Nokia, Sony Ericsson & Motorola.
I wanted to take advantage of Vodaphones new Internet promo & the v3 I had wouldn't load the web as it was configured for O2 networks.
Initially I was drawn like a moth to a flame when I saw the shiny d840 Samsung & at £130 thought it good value for money for the features it has. My wife has a z400 (slimmed down version of the d600 with 3G) & I really liked the GUI on that so thought a streamlined version of that would be great. There are touches about this phone which are fab: assigning a click noise to the slider! Ha what a hoot. Samsung have really done their homework with the menu system, showing submenus when you hover over. I didn't like the default settings for texting when you want to write a message it defaults to Ab & you have to then open up a menu to get your T9 or numbers or symbols, this I find long-winded & when you go back to texting it reverts back to Ab-Pain!
Then there's the music player-mmm! Like the phones got 60 Meg of internal memory & if you've got a 2 gig card with a bunch of tracks on you, you got to copy them first to the phones memory so the player can play them. OK Samsung so what if I want to shuffle 25 tracks, my phones memory is now crammed full, so now I have got to go back to deleting tracks to free up the memory again. Pointless time wasting exercise! You can only play tracks from the memory card one at a time. Doh!
Yes as others have said the slider mechanism is built like a Ford-it works for now but you know it isn't going to last.
Music player, no key to switch it off from stand-by the red button just puts it into sleep mode, ever draining what little Battery you have left, which leaves me to conclude:
Battery Life! 2.5 hrs talktime & 100 hrs standby quoted by Samsung. That's a load of rubbish! Try charging overnight (off) switching on to go to work, sending 1 text message & the phone shutting down with no battery around 1pm, no lie that's what I am getting at the moment. OK there might be a faulty Battery here but the 2nd day I had it I was browsing for 30 mins & it went from 3 bars down to one bar flashing in that time!
I'll now be taking it back & find something that at least holds charge for 36 hrs. You see I've got better things to do in life than to worry about putting my phone on charge to use it for 12 hours at work.
You can't dislike Samsung though-they've done more in 2 years for innovative designs, slimming down slide-phones than Nokia have done in 4, their phones are quirky, modern & above all about a third less to buy. I worry that the race to market desirable phones such as this means we are all supposed to accept form over functionality?
Pros:
- Slim design.
- Ease of use of controls.
- Good GUI.
- Thin for your pocket.
- Good features-camera, music player, Internet, video.
- Easy metal keypad.
Cons:
- On closer inspection non durable build quality, easy to scratch screen, wobbly slider, chrome plastic! (Yep the type that will degrade to white in no time).
- Internet browser lags with limited viewing of non mobile friendly web pages.
- the music player having to copy tracks from memory card to phone to hear a playlist. No easy way of turning player off when on stand-by.
- V. Poor battery life (even without faulty battery).
All in all if you want a flash looker & don't mind carrying a charger with you everywhere then I guess this is the phone for you. If you actually use the phone for work then look elsewhere!
